Transaction ff4423b07c39a21ecbcbe8676aa9c68fcf6ff65a482a2a13016596a337912891
3 Input
2 Outputs
- ff4423b07c39a21ecbcbe8676aa9c68fcf6ff65a482a2a13016596a337912891:0
- ff4423b07c39a21ecbcbe8676aa9c68fcf6ff65a482a2a13016596a337912891:1
value 1004475
address 1MdKHspfdR7k2ZN9JyHHdYt3eDWTetoHTN
value 58340000
address 155DLRaXfN3dKnvx8y1gCK6MaDnvXnprry